Analysis
The most recent figure for brazil — veneer sheets — import value in Peru is 19 1000 USD, measured in 2016.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 90.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, brazil — veneer sheets — import value in Peru peaked at 212 1000 USD in 2003 and was at its lowest, 16 1000 USD, in 2012.
Peru ranks 44th of 62 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
